ABSTRACT:Duty cycle is a charge/discharge profile representing demands associated with a specific application placed on a module energy storage system (ESS). Assessing applicability of module ESS with duty cycle hasattracted increasing attention in renewable energy. Duty cycle test curve of module ESS was constructed and analyzed in this paper. The construction included extracting common factors from module ESS operation data with factor analysis, clustering original fragments with K-means cluster analyzing common factors, constructing a typical duty cycle curves with representative testing fragments of each clusters data. Duty cycles of module ESS in scheduling output, output smoothness, combined scheduling and smoothness application, for example, were respectively constructed and analyzed. Results showed that combination of factor analysis and K-means clustering methods can effectively identify and quantify characteristic parameters of duty cycle test curve for assessing applicability of module ESS.关键词
